Output dd10bc32fc942c3b62b14326391814861fef302875357d626608676077044630:3

value
104159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d7250a7b7289bb91dd23f8fe0071a0ea833b80 OP_EQUAL
address
3MpiKG8TnVPmFTaMxd2k5nEBrBZmASVcJS
transaction
dd10bc32fc942c3b62b14326391814861fef302875357d626608676077044630
confirmations
163255
spent
true